Florida’s 7’9 basketball recruit is already breaking NCAA record books

Olivier Rioux is the tallest teenager ever, and he’s coming to the Florida Gators.

Are we seeing a renaissance of the massive human playing college basketball? Purdue’s Zach Edey dominated the NCAA at 7’4, 300 pounds en route to back-to-back Wooden Award trophies and a Final Four appearance. Tacko Fall mesmerized the college basketball and NBA world in his NCAA tournament matchup with Zion Williamson and Duke.

Now, we might be getting a player who is larger than both of them, and I have no idea how that’s possible. IMG Academy’s Olivier Rioux is a Florida commit in the class of 2024, who WAS 7’6—last year.

If he’s truly 7’9, then that would make him the tallest player in college basketball history, passing former Florida Tech and Mountain State player Paul Sturgess, who was 7’8. Rioux is also the tallest teenager ever. His basketball highlight tape looks exactly how you think someone that big would look playing against your average high schooler.
